Abstract:
The purposes of this research were to: 1) develop the collaborative teaching
evaluation system, 2) evaluate the collaborative teaching evaluation system, and
3) develop and validate the efficiency of the collaborative teaching evaluation
system. The target of this research included 40 administrative team and teachers in
13 private vocational educational institutes. The descriptive statistics employed in
this study included arithmetic mean, IOC, Cronbachs Alpha Method, and E1/E2 for
the efficiency of the training course. The results can be summarized as follows:
1. The development of the collaborative teaching evaluation system for
vocational educational institutes can be divided into 6 aspects, i.e. 1) the input factor
consisted of teachers, students, learning and teaching activities, laws and promulgations
related to education, self evaluation by teachers themselves and their colleagues,
and the evaluation committee. 2) The process factor is based on Rodriguez Campos
(2008) integrated with teaching evaluation method by Glaser (1965) and concept
framework of collaborative evaluation approach by Thipkamporn (2545 BE). 3) The
product factor revealed that there were 4 types of evaluation for trained teachers,
i.e. response evaluation, learning achievement evaluation, evaluation on changing
behavior after training, and effects on the organization evaluation. 4) The product
evaluation showed that students had more roles and took part in learning and teaching. Other advantages included teaching evaluation handbook and teaching
evaluation system for the administrative team to evaluate their teachers in the
organization. 5) Meta evaluation system was employed to evaluate the process and
product again by the specialists. 6) Feedback from the analysis of relationship between
product and objective was used to develop the process, product, and target.
2. The assessment results of the collaborative teaching evaluation system for
vocational educational institutes based on Rodriguez Campos (2008) integrated with
teaching evaluation method by Glaser (1965) and concept framework of collaborative evaluation approach by Thipkamporn (2545 BE) showed that the teaching handbook
was very appropriate with the average of 4.48. The 2nd handbook on the process of
teaching evaluation evaluated by the specialists based on Rodriguez Campos (2008)
integrated with teaching evaluation method by Glaser (1965) and concept framework
of collaborative evaluation approach by Thipkamporn (2545 BE) showed very high
appropriateness at 4.62. The 3rd handbook on self evaluation based on collaborative
evaluation approach showed that the developed approach was very good at 4.67.
3. The efficiency of the collaborative teaching evaluation system for vocational
educational institutes reached high efficiency at 82.17/ 85.15 with the average on the
practical part at 75%. The efficiency of the training program on 5 learning modules
reached the average of 83.55%.
